    Last winter I build a new machine. It was my first design. I had a cheap China CNC before that but I was unsatisfied with its non existing capabilities to mill in aluminium. Now I have had it for some time and I have milled A LOT of of aluminium parts for my RC helicopters so I would like to share the machine with you. I am very pleased with it in every possible way. There is 2 parts I did not manufacture myself and thats the T-slot bed and the holder for the spindel motor. These parts I bought here: https://www.sorotec.de/shop/

    If you want to build one yourself or you just are curious you can see and download all the 3D files here in Autodesk Fusion 360 format: https://a360.co/35qALxA

    The last picture shows the very first part I made with this machine which is a a little bearing holder for my smallest RC helicopter (Gaui X3).
